[From Foreword] The Cobra was, and is, a phenomenon. The mating of the elegant and simple AC Ace body to the brutal power and stump-pulling torque of a large capacity American V8 engine was an inspiration, even if not a new idea, for Sydney Allard certainly got there first. Automotive history is littered with other people's attempts to create similar packages - Sunbeam 丁iger, Daimler SP250 (Dart), MGB V8, TR7 V8, etc - but none has succeeded as brilliantly as the Cobra. Simply, the Cobra was greater than the sum of its parts.
